タグ付けされた質問 「named-pipe」

4
Windowsでは、コマンドラインでstdoutを(名前付き)パイプにリダイレクトできますか?
リダイレクトする方法があり、標準出力における処理のWin32のコンソールをする名前付きパイプは?名前付きパイプはWindowsに組み込まれているため、便利な概念ですが、コマンドラインから使用されることはありません。 すなわち。のようなexample.exe >\\.\mypipe。(この構文は正しくないかもしれませんが、ポイントを得ることができます。)stdoutとstderrを同時に異なるパイプにリダイレクトできるようにしたいと思います。 IOの遅さ、IOバッファー、ファイルロック、アクセス権、使用可能なハードディスク領域、上書きの決定、意味のない永続性などの処理を回避するために、物理ファイルを代わりに使用しないようにします。 もう1つの理由は、従来のWindows のツールセットは、Unixほど多くの(テキスト)ファイルベースの哲学に基づいて設計されていないためです。また、名前付きパイプは、Windowsに簡単にマウントできませんでした。 最後に、優れたコンセプトをうまく活用できれば好奇心があります。

3
トラフィックを記録するためのプロキシとしてnetcatを使う
httpリクエストとレスポンスをファイルに記録するためのプロキシとしてnetcatを使い、それからトラフィックを検査するためにこれらを調整したいのです。 wireharkを考えてください。 'fifo'は名前付きパイプ、 'in'と 'out'はファイル、ポート8080はnetcatプロキシ、ポート8081はserverです。 本当ながら。猫FIFA nc -l -p 8080 |ティーティーインnc localhost 8081 | tee -a out 1> fifo;終わった 問題点 Netcatは最初の要求後に応答を停止します(ループは無視されますか?)。 Netcatがmsgで失敗する localhost [127.0.0.1] 8081 (tproxy) : Connection refused 8081でサーバーが使用できない場合すなわちnetcatの起動時に8081を実行したくありません。

1
名前付きパイプを介してFFMPEGにJPEG画像を送るにはどうすればよいですか?
通常はFFMPEGにファイルシステムからの画像を供給することができます。 -f image2 しかし、名前付きパイプが入力としてある場合、これは機能しません。FFMPEGは、「0〜4の範囲のインデックス」が見つからないと文句を言います。明らかにFFMPEGは0 ... xという名前の画像が欲しいのですが、名前付きパイプでは不可能です。 名前付きパイプでこれを行うための正しい方法は何ですか?
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.